2. Pressure
The strain of the thread is an important side of “Tips on how to Thread a Necchi” as a result of it ensures that the thread is correctly tensioned for easy stitching. With out the right rigidity, the thread could also be too unfastened, which might trigger skipped stitches or loops, or it might be too tight, which might trigger the thread to interrupt or the material to pucker.
- Balanced rigidity: Balanced rigidity is achieved when the higher and decrease threads are evenly tensioned. This leads to neat and safe stitches that aren’t too unfastened or too tight.
- Adjusting rigidity: The strain may be adjusted by turning the strain dial on the machine. The strain dial is often positioned on the highest or facet of the machine, and it has numbers or symbols that point out the strain setting.
- Kinds of thread: Several types of thread require completely different rigidity settings. For instance, thicker threads require extra rigidity than thinner threads.
- Kinds of cloth: Several types of cloth additionally require completely different rigidity settings. For instance, delicate materials require much less rigidity than heavy materials.

3. Needle
Within the context of “Tips on how to Thread a Necchi,” the needle performs a vital function in guaranteeing profitable and environment friendly stitching. Selecting the right needle measurement and sort is important for attaining optimum sew high quality, stopping injury to the material, and maximizing the lifespan of the machine.
- Needle measurement: The needle measurement refers to its thickness, which is measured in millimeters or gauge. Thicker needles are used for heavier materials, whereas thinner needles are used for lighter materials. Utilizing the right needle measurement helps to create the correct amount of penetration and forestall skipped stitches or cloth injury.
- Needle sort: There are several types of needles designed for particular functions. For instance, common needles are appropriate for many basic stitching duties. Different varieties embody ballpoint needles for knit materials, sharp needles for woven materials, and metallic needles for metallic threads.
- Needle sharpness: The sharpness of the needle can be essential. A pointy needle will penetrate the material cleanly, whereas a uninteresting needle could cause snags or tears. It is very important substitute needles usually to keep up their sharpness.
- Needle compatibility: Needles will not be common and will range in compatibility with completely different Necchi stitching machine fashions. It is very important seek the advice of the machine handbook or the producer’s web site to find out the right needle sort and measurement to your particular machine.

4. Bobbin
Within the context of “Tips on how to Thread a Necchi,” the bobbin performs a vital function in creating the lockstitch that holds the material collectively. Correct winding and insertion of the bobbin into the machine are important to make sure easy and environment friendly stitching.
- Bobbin winding: The bobbin ought to be evenly and tightly wound with thread to forestall tangles and guarantee easy feeding throughout stitching.
- Bobbin insertion: The bobbin ought to be accurately inserted into the bobbin case and positioned within the machine in line with the producer’s directions. Incorrect insertion can result in thread jams or rigidity issues.
- Bobbin thread: The thread used on the bobbin ought to match the thread used on the highest of the machine to make sure balanced rigidity and correct sew formation.
- Bobbin case: The bobbin case holds the bobbin and guides the thread throughout stitching. It ought to be clear and freed from lint or particles to forestall thread tangles or breakage.
